
CarbonSix joined the City of Douglas to help complete the seven years of planning the city had dedicated to reimagining a former outpatient hospital as a city complex housing a modern city hall, police department, and department of public works facility. This adaptive reuse project included an 11,000 square-foot office renovation for administrative and public spaces and an 1,800-square-foot garage addition for police vehicles. The cost-effective design and construction adhere to stringent accessibility, security, and regulatory standards while leveraging existing infrastructure for sustainability. The resulting space provides the opportunity to strengthen community connections and supports the long-term growth and legacy the City of Douglas.
